How to Replace a Bathroom Faucet
In our homes and apartments, there are many simple devices and appliances that can be replaced independently without needing external specialists. One such device is a bathroom or kitchen faucet.
Often, faucets fail due to poor water quality or an overdue replacement of the main filter cartridge.
The most common faucet damages are:
- sand or small particles scratch the faucet cartridges, causing water to leak from the spout even when the tap is closed;
- one of the threaded connections on the faucet comes loose;
- the brass alloy used in most faucets corrodes and deteriorates.
The last two issues are most typical for low-quality, inexpensive Chinese faucets made from poor-grade brass alloys. In contrast, high-quality European faucets are made entirely or partially from stainless steel.
Required Tools for Faucet Replacement
To avoid running back and forth for tools during the replacement process, it's best to prepare all necessary equipment in advance and keep it close to the work area.
You will need:
- adjustable wrench (two are better),
- slip-joint pliers,
- sealant,
- PTFE tape or hemp packing,
- plumber’s hemp,
- graphite gasket maker (tube),
- rubber or paronite washers for ½ and ¾ inch,
- a small container for collecting water.
All these tools and materials are readily available in any DIY store, and many are likely already in a typical household.
Step-by-Step Guide to Replacing a Faucet
First, shut off the cold and hot water supply to the old faucet. After closing the valves on the pipes, drain any remaining water from the old faucet and release excess pressure. To do this, open both taps on the faucet.
Once all water and air have drained from the tap, loosen the large nuts that secure the faucet to the eccentric fittings connecting it to the plastic pipes of the plumbing system. The old faucet is now removed. Next, inspect the condition of the eccentric fittings—consider replacing them, especially since new faucets always include new eccentric fittings as standard.
Typically, the standard distance between pipe connection points in faucets is 150 mm. If the actual distance between pipe outlets differs, eccentric fittings can help compensate for this discrepancy to some extent. To adjust, slightly tighten or loosen the eccentric, allowing the offset pipe section to shift toward the center or edge, thereby increasing the center-to-center distance.
After setting the correct distance between the eccentric fittings’ outlets, proceed to install the new faucet. First, secure the eccentric fittings tightly using plumber’s hemp and gasket maker. Wrap a small amount of hemp around the external threads of the eccentric, then apply a layer of graphite gasket maker or regular sealant. If any of these materials are unavailable, PTFE tape (‘FUM’) can be used instead.
Then, screw both eccentric fittings into the pipes with perfect symmetry. It’s crucial to do this simultaneously—otherwise, the fittings may end up at uneven heights, causing the new faucet to tilt sideways after installation. Once the fittings are properly aligned and the center-to-center distance matches the new faucet, proceed to final installation.
Essentially, only two mounting nuts remain to be tightened—but there’s a small trick here. To avoid damaging the faucet’s nut coating, wrap them with electrical tape before tightening with an adjustable wrench or pliers. Once fully secured, remove the tape.
